    Edit Photo Details A Dark Night For the Thai People   #bangkok #grief #royalpalace #mourners #kingofthailand #bhumiboladulyadej #yourverticalworld
    After a 9-hour wait, I was estatic like everyone else to be finally marching towards the Throne Hall to say my last farewell prayers before my King. It was a night like none other: filled with both profound sorrow and joy. The 9 hours of waiting was auspicious for our late King Rama the 9th and 9 is Thailand’s most auspicious number. Just before our designated group was led on our final walk, a lovely full moon rose above the Grand Palace. What a great gift from heaven on this precious night!
